In the late morning light of June 18, 1986, a day that marked his wedding anniversary and fell just two months shy of his planned retirement, Jefferson County Deputy Sheriff William James Truesdale was working an off-duty security job at the Citywide Bank on South Wadsworth Boulevard in Lakewood, Colorado. At 53 years old, the male deputy was a seasoned officer, familiar with the risks that came with the badge. That morning, the inherent dangers of his profession tragically materialized.
